WebThe main difference between them is that stars twinkle and planets don’t have the ability to twinkle. Also, planets orbit around the Sun while stars don’t. Another distinguishing feature is that stars are made up of hydrogen and helium while planets are made up of solids, liquids, gases, or a combination of the above three things.
